# Approvals: Nightly Backfill Scheduler (Dunecart)

All changes to the Dunecart backfill scheduler require written approval before merge. This includes cron expression edits, retry policy changes, and new dataset registrations. Submit a request via the Approvals board with the affected tables and expected runtime. Backfills touching the billing dataset need a second reviewer. Emergency changes may be applied first but must be ratified within one business day by the approver listed below.

approver of kawig-fahof = Wenvan Prair

Each evaluation runs in its own process, killed on a hard CPU and memory budget; results stream back over a local pipe. Reviewers should confirm that no code path imports the host runtime into the sandbox, and that the escape-hatch flag remains disabled in all environments. Workers are spawned by the Quillbarn supervisor, which reads its limits at boot. The supervisor must be launched with these configuration values.

settings of fafog-haduf:
ZORIX_PIN=4648
ZORIX_METRICS_HOST=metrics.zorix.paliqsys.corp
ZORIX_LOG_LEVEL=info
ZORIX_TENANT=druix

Gross-Margin Review — Pellbright Retail (Managers Only)

Q2 review complete. Blended margin down 2.1 points, driven by freight costs and discounting at the Northvale branches. Corrective actions: tighten markdown approvals, renegotiate carrier rates, shift volume to the Selmora line. Branch managers must submit margin bridges by month-end. Targets for the second half are set out in the confidential note below.

management briefing: Project Ulavan slips by two quarters because of the staffing delay.

☐ Landlord site audit — Brindlewood Property Group will walk the third floor of Haverly House between 09:00 and 11:00 on the new starter's first day. Team assistants should make sure the starter's desk area is clear of unboxed equipment and that meeting rooms along the east corridor are tidy. The auditor will check that all staff on the floor display valid passes. The starter's temporary badge code is below.

door code, yagap-bahof: bdg-O-05